Perez's loss of track time 'a shame'

Sergio Perez endured a tough afternoon at the wheel of his Force India. The Mexican completed just 19 laps of the Bahrain International Circuit when his other Mercedes-powered competitors far exceeded that. Mercedes-powered cars have been the most impressive in terms of reliability so far this preseason, but that isn't to say they're invincible. Perez didn't spend too much time on the track “It’s a shame to lose the track time this afternoon,' said Perez of his troubles in Bahrain today. 'But I think we can feel quite positive about what we have learned this week. Every lap in the car gives us more information and we are always trying something new. I was not able to do the long runs...
